Transaction 25239aeae2a3685fd1edfc64bb50feb4ecdd5fa87380dee1e46a21d4a98b6b3f

1 Input
2 Outputs
  • 25239aeae2a3685fd1edfc64bb50feb4ecdd5fa87380dee1e46a21d4a98b6b3f:0
  • value  41420
    address  39b5yFF298d2Zjpm1ZKjKdGQ9m8GvQ9meG
  • 25239aeae2a3685fd1edfc64bb50feb4ecdd5fa87380dee1e46a21d4a98b6b3f:1
  • value  1010637
    address  3Mc32ofWtr5uyhCNqfs9UeSYKhRLvnjSvj